The Ultimate Labor Day Potato Salad makes sure to fulfill all the reviving and relaxing promises of the holiday in each and every bite. The potatoes are tender and fluffy, taking a leisurely summer swim in a creamy, savory, and tangy sauce with plenty of herb and garlic flavor. White onion brings the crunch and bacon brings the saltiness and fattiness to the party. Ingredients
- 8 slices bacon
- 4 medium-sized red potatoes, cut into 3/4-inch cubes
- 1 large white onion, cut into 1/2-inch-thick strips
- 2 teaspoons salt
- 1 1/4 teaspoons pepper
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1/4 teaspoon dried crushed rosemary
- 1/8 teaspoon celery seeds
- 5 1/2 tablespoons mayonnaise
- 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
- 2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
- fresh parsley, optional, chopped, for garnish
Directions
Step 1 -Preheat the grill to medium-high heat.
Step 2 -In a large skillet on the stove-top over medium-high heat, cook the bacon until crisp, about 8-10 minutes.
Step 3 -Transfer the bacon to paper towels to drain, reserving the drippings in the skillet.
Step 4 -Crumble the bacon.
Step 5 -Add the potatoes, onion, salt, pepper, paprika, garlic powder, thyme, rosemary, and celery seeds to the hot drippings in the skillet, tossing to coat everything.
Step 6 -Using a slotted spoon, transfer the potato mixture to a grill wok or a metal basket.
Step 7 -Grill the potato mixture, covered with the grill lid and stirring every 5 minutes, until the potatoes are tender, about 30 minutes.
Step 8 -Transfer the potato mixture to a large bowl.
Step 9 -Add the m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, and Worcestershire sauce to the mixture, tossing everything together to coat.
Step 10 -Stir in the bacon crumbles.
Step 11 -Garnish with parsley and serve warm.
